# Env file — Cartwheel dispatch, driver-assignment heuristic
# Scope: staging only. Do not promote to prod.
# The heuristic weights (proximity, shift balance, refusal rate) are tuned
# for the Velmont pilot region and will misbehave elsewhere.
# Review notes: heuristic service runs unprivileged; it reads weights
# read-only from the tuning store and writes nothing back.
# Only one sensitive value exists in this file: the tuning-store access
# credential, consumed at boot and never logged.
# That credential is set on the following line.

secret setting of faduf-bahop: LEDGER_TOKEN8=c3b363be

**Action item (INC-447):** Last release shipped search relevance weights that were tuned against a stale index snapshot, which is why ranking looked weird for a day. Going forward, tuning notes must be attached to the release checklist before cut. Marella already drafted the new process — please gate the next release on it. The tuning notes and checklist template live here.

operations page: https://jenkins.zemvarcloud.local/job/merge_requests/repo/build/73930b4b30f0a8ed

## Formula sandbox tuning

User-supplied formulas in Gridmoor execute inside a restricted interpreter with hard ceilings on time, memory, and call depth. Reviewers should confirm any change to these ceilings is justified in the PR description, since raising them widens the abuse surface. Defaults were chosen from production traces. The current limits are as follows.

limits module of tafog-fawip:
WEIGHTS = {
    "julix": 57,
    "lamys": 992,
    "kasvan": 209,
    "quenok": 750,
    "alddor": 259,
    "oliath": 1009,
    "wenix": 815,
}

### Off-site Run: Reservoir Water Samples

- Grab the cooler of water samples from the Tarnbeck Reservoir intake shed — twelve bottles, all labelled by the Fennel Hydrology crew. Keep them chilled the whole way; ice packs are in the break-room freezer. They're due at the Oakmere lab before 16:00, no exceptions, since the assays start same-day. When the courier meets you at the lab gate, apply the hand-over instruction noted just below.

handover note for yagef-bagep: the drudor pelius courier leaves the kasdor zorvan norir ledger at gate 8016 under passcode 755406